Building foundation repair services involve assessing and restoring the structural support of a property’s foundation. These services typically include identifying issues such as cracking, settling, or shifting that can compromise the stability of a building. Repair methods may involve underpinning, piering, or stabilization techniques designed to reinforce the existing foundation and prevent further movement. Professionals in this field utilize specialized equipment and techniques to ensure that repairs are durable and effective, helping to maintain the integrity of the property over time.
Problems that building foundation repair addresses often stem from so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ial construction. Common signs of foundation issues include uneven flooring, visible cracks in walls or ceilings, doors and windows that stick or do not close properly, and gaps around door frames. Left unaddressed, these issues can lead to more severe structural damage, increased repair costs, and safety concerns. Repair services aim to correct these problems by restoring proper support and alignment, thereby reducing the risk of further deterioration.

Foundation Repair Cost - Typical expenses for foundation repairs can range from $2,000 to $7,500, depending on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s may cost closer to $2,000, while extensive underpinning can exceed $10,000. Variations depend on the project's complexity and local rates.
Repair Methods and Costs - Different repair techniques, such as piering or mudjacking, influence overall costs. Piering often cost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per pier, while mudjacking generally ranges from $500 to $1,500 per section. The choice of method impacts the total expense.
Factors Affecting Expenses - Soil conditions, foundation size, and the severity of settlement can significantly affect repair costs. What are signs that a building foundation needs repair?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ors and windows that stick or don’t close properly, and gaps around window frames or doorjambs.
How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method, but most proj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
Are foundation repairs disruptive to my property? Some level of disruption may occur during repair work, such as limited access to certain areas, but experienced contractors aim to minimize inconvenience.
What causes foundation problems in buildings? Common causes include soil movement, poor drainage, tree roots, and changes in moisture levels that lead to soil expansion or contraction.
